Related: Culture Forums, Support ForumsA Pair of Classic Rock Events Will Bring Fleetwood Mac and the Eagles to the Coasts.
'As the Rolling Stones, Paul McCartney and the Who took the stage last fall at the Desert Trip festival in Southern California, Mick Fleetwood was in the stands, loving every minute of it.
I was there like a stalker fan, Mr. Fleetwood said. And it was so cool! It was emotionally charged.
This summer Mr. Fleetwood, the drummer and founding member of Fleetwood Mac, will have something of a classic-rock festival of his own, with a pair of two-day concerts set for Los Angeles and New York, featuring Fleetwood Mac; the Eagles; Steely Dan; the Doobie Brothers; Journey; and Earth, Wind and Fire. The first two shows, called The Classic West, will be held at Dodger Stadium in Los Angeles on July 15 and 16; the second, The Classic East, will be at Citi Field on July 29 and 30, with the same lineup.
Seeing people of every age group really going at it and being supercharged, it was a trip, Mr. Fleetwood said, calling from Maui, where he lives. And thats what weve been touching on.'>>>

In 1974 the were scheduled to play an outdoor concert for the University of Northern Iowa Spring celebration, Suni Daze, together with REO and the Eagles. The promoters wanted REO to open the show, and the Eagles to close, with Steely Dan in the middle position. Fagen and Becker refused to go on unless they were the closing act.
It had rained the night before, but the weather that Sunday was sunny and mild, and the crowd sat on the ground in front of the stage, either on blankets, or on the grass. Despite this, the announced reason for Steely Dan's refusal to perform was that they felt conditions were unsafe. I knew the people who put that show together and that was pure bullshit. Fagen and Becker threw a temper tantrum, pure and simple.
On the other hand, the Eagles (pre-Joe Walsh) played for nearly three hours, performing virtually every song from their three albums: "Eagles," "Desperado" and "On the Border."
